With the great Hanshin-Awaji Earthquake now 20 years behind us, In this paper, I reflect upon methods and attitudes regarding disaster waste management then and now. Additionally, based on my experiences and lessons learned during the support efforts provided following the Great Eastern Japan Earthquake I propose new approaches to dealing with preparedness for treatment of disaster debris in the case of any possible future large-scale disasters.
